About Boundedness for some Datalog and Datalogneg Programs

IRÈNE GUESSARIAN and MARCOS VELOSO-PEIXOTO, L.I.T.P.

Université Paris 6, 4 Place Jussieu 75252 Paris Cédex 05, France. E-mail: ig{at}litp.ibp frveloso{at}dmi.ens.fr

We prove that boundedness is decidable for uniformly connected Datalog programs. We study various semantics (cumulative, non-deterministic, well-founded and stratified) for Datalogneg programs. We compare the various boundedness notions for Datalogneg programs according to these semantics and we show that boundedness is undecidable for Datalogneg programs.
